What is DaVinci Resolve?
DaVinci Resolve is a professional video editing, color grading, visual effects, and audio post-production suite from Blackmagic Design that's used on Hollywood films and TV shows — yet offers a remarkably full-featured free version. It's renowned especially for its industry-leading color grading, which has made it a staple in professional post-production, but it has grown into a complete all-in-one solution that handles the entire post workflow in a single application, from the first cut to the final mix.
The software combines several powerful toolsets into one program: editing for cutting and assembling footage, the legendary color page for precise grading and finishing, Fusion for visual effects and motion graphics, and Fairlight for professional audio. This means an editor can take a project from raw clips all the way to a polished, color-graded, sound-mixed final export without leaving the app or round-tripping between tools. It supports high-end formats and collaborative workflows used in professional studios, while its interface, though deep, is approachable enough for serious hobbyists to learn. The free version is extraordinarily capable, with a paid Studio version adding advanced features.
DaVinci Resolve is used by professional filmmakers, colorists, video editors, and increasingly by serious content creators and YouTubers who want professional results. What is Vizard?
Vizard is an AI-powered video tool that turns long-form videos into ready-to-post short clips, automatically and affordably. For creators, marketers and businesses sitting on hours of webinars, podcasts, interviews and recordings, Vizard solves a real problem: extracting the most engaging moments and packaging them as polished vertical clips for TikTok, Reels, Shorts and LinkedIn — without the hours of manual editing that this repurposing normally demands.
The workflow is fast and simple. You upload a long video or paste a link, and Vizard's AI analyzes the content to identify the most compelling segments, then automatically cuts them into short clips, adds accurate animated captions, reframes the video to vertical, and applies templates so the output looks professional. What might take an editor hours per clip is reduced to minutes, letting one piece of long content become a steady stream of social-ready posts. You can review and fine-tune the clips, adjust captions and branding, and export quickly.
Vizard's appeal is the combination of speed, quality and price. It makes consistent short-form content production realistic for solo creators and small teams who can't afford dedicated video editors, and it helps larger teams scale their output dramatically. Captions improve accessibility and engagement (since much social video is watched without sound), and the AI's clip selection saves the tedious work of scrubbing through footage to find the good parts.
